Stop Basement Flooding with a Sump Pump System
A sump pump system acts as a crucial barrier against basement flooding. This effective system consists of a sump pit, which collects water that drifts into your basement. A submersible pump subsequently pumps the collected water out of your home, preventing flooding.
To maximize the performance of your sump pump system, regular maintenance are necessary. This includes keeping the container free from debris and verifying the pump's activity.
Grasping Your Sump Pump Basin and Components
A collection chamber acts as the heart of your sump pump system. It's a pit that collects water that seeps into your basement or crawlspace, channeling it towards the sump pump for removal. To effectively understand how to care for your sump pump, it's crucial to learn about its parts.
- First, you have the basin itself, which can be made of concrete and is typically rectangular in shape.
- Following that, there's the sump pump, responsible for transferring water out of the basin and away from your home.
- Finally, you have the float switch that activates the sump pump when water reaches a height.
These fundamental elements work in synergy to keep your basement dry and protect your home from moisture problems. By understanding each component's function, you can effectively care for your sump pump system and extend its life.

Selecting the Right Sump Pump for Your Basement Needs
Protecting your basement from flooding is essential. A properly functioning sump pump can be your first line of defense against water damage. However, with so many choices available, selecting the right sump pump for your specific needs can seem overwhelming. Consider the capacity of your basement and the amount of rainfall your area typically experiences. A powerful pump may be necessary if you live in a pump sump alarm region prone to heavy storms.
It's also important to determine between submersible and pedestal pumps. Submersible pumps are completely submerged in the water, while pedestal pumps have the motor outside the basin. Submersible pumps are generally more reliable, but pedestal pumps may be easier to install.
Finally, don't forget about a secondary power source. A battery backup system or generator can ensure your sump pump continues to function even during a power outage.
Dealing With Common Sump Pump Issues
A sump pump is a vital part for protecting your home from flood. While they are generally reliable, there are some common problems that can arise. Here's a look at some of the most frequent sump pump concerns and how to address them.
One common situation is a broken sensor. If the mechanism isn't detecting water, the pump won't turn on. Check the mechanism for blockage.
Another common reason is a blocked outlet. This can occur from sediment accumulating in the channel. Unclog the tube to restore water flow.
Finally, a broken electrical component is another likelihood. If your pump won't start, it may be time to swap out the electrical component. Regular inspections can help minimize these common issues.
